Micheal worked as a technician for Southwestern Bell for 13 years before getting his first degree.
Several years of experience in Orange County, California at Gibson, Dunn and Crutcher, one of the largest international law firms in the United States. Michael rotated through their litigation, and corporate departments.
Later, he would work for a period of time at a smaller firm in Orange County where I worked primarily on environmental insurance litigation
And In 1999, Michael returned to Hot Springs and opened Sanders Law Firm, P.A.
Bachelor of Science in Business Administration in 1992 by attending the University of Arkansas at Monticello.
Doctor of Jurisprudence degree in 1995 from Stanford Law School
